Potholes repair services involve fixing damaged sections of asphalt or concrete pavements to restore a smooth, safe surface. This process typically includes removing the compromised material, preparing the area for repairs, and filling or patching the hole to match the surrounding surface.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and materials to ensure the repair is durable and blends seamlessly with the existing pavement, helping to prevent further deterioration over time. Pothole repairs are essential for maintaining the integrity of driveways, parking lots, and other paved areas, especially in regions where weather conditions can cause pavement to crack and break apart.
These services address common problems such as crumbling asphalt, large or deep holes, and surface cracks that can worsen if left unattended. Potholes can pose safety hazards to pedestrians and vehicles, leading to potential accidents or damage to tires and suspension systems. Repairing potholes also helps prevent water from seeping into the pavement foundation, which can cause further erosion and more extensive damage. Timely repairs can extend the lifespan of pavement surfaces, reduce long-term repair costs, and improve the overall appearance of a property’s exterior.

The overview below groups typical Potholes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Auburn,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or pothole fixes,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, especially for potholes less than a foot in diameter. Costs can vary depending on the size and location of the damage.
Moderate Repairs - Larger potholes or multiple repairs usually cost between $600 and $1,200. These projects often involve more extensive patching or surface work and are common in areas with frequent wear and tear. Fewer jobs reach the higher end of this range.
Full Pavement Patching - When a section of pavement requires significant patching, costs generally range from $1,200 to $3,000. This level of repair is typical for larger damaged areas or repeated issues that need more comprehensive work.
Complete Replacement - Full driveway or street resurfacing can cost $3,000 to $8,000 or more, depending on size and complexity. Larger, more complex projects such as extensive resurfacing or reconstruction can reach $10,000+, though these are less common for routine pothole repair need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es potholes to form? Potholes develop when water seeps into cracks in the pavement and freezes, expanding the cracks. Repeated traffic then causes the weakened surface to break apart, creating potholes.
How can potholes be repaired effectively? Local contractors typically use methods such as patching, cold or hot asphalt overlays, or full-depth repairs to restore damaged pavement and prevent further deterioration.
Are there different types of pothole repair services available? Yes, service providers may offer various repair options including temporary patches, permanent repairs, or preventative maintenance to address different sizes and locations of potholes.
What signs indicate a need for pothole repair? Visible holes, cracks around the pavement, or areas where the surface has broken apart are common signs that a pothole repair may be necessary.
Can pothole repair help prevent future pavement damage? Properly repaired potholes can reduce the risk of further pavement deterioration and help maintain the roadway’s safety and integrity over time.
